Finally, iOS 11 is here in all its glory, and in case the software's new features weren't exciting enough, Apple is also releasing hundreds of new emoji.

On Friday the company announced a trove of highly-anticipated emoji will be coming to iPhones and iPads, including more beloved food items, animals, smiley faces, and mythical creatures. Apple also announced it's introducing gender-neutral characters in this update.

iOS 11.1 will also feature the emoji announced on World Emoji Day, which include Woman with Headscarf, Breastfeeding mom, Bearded guy, a Zombie, a Sandwich, a Coconut, a Zebra, a T-Rex, and much more.

And one that's sure to make its way onto your "Frequently Used" page is the "Love-You Gesture," presented as the American Sign Language “I love you” hand sign.

The new emoji — which Apple says are "adapted from approved characters in Unicode 10" — are all set to debut on the developer and beta previews of iOS 11.1 next week. Get. Psyched.
